Dharamshala 3 June 2005- The developing countries have the opportunity to not to fall in the path of blind material development pursued by the advanced countries which has caused many problems, His Holiness the Dalai Lama said in an inaugural address yesterday at a national seminar on Strategies for the Development of Himachal Pradesh at the Club House, McLeod Gunj.
The development should be holistic with a balanced emphasis on both inner spiritual and external material development, His Holiness said.
His Holiness presented Divya Himachal Award for Excellence for the year 2005 to film actor and former Censor Board chairman Anupam Kher for his significant contribution to society.
“It’s a special pleasure to present this award to a person who possess all the human qualities and emotions”, His Holiness said.
His Holiness also released a poster of Kher’s soon-to-be-released movie Maine Gandhi Ko Nahin Mara.
The seminar organised by Divya Himachal newspaper group analysed the prevailing realities and climate of development in the state of Himachal Pradesh.
